#86ef5d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#86ef5d is composed of 52.5% red, 93.7% green and 36.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 43.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 61.1%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 103.2 degrees, a saturation of 82% and a lightness of 65.1%. #86ef5d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ffba with #0ddf00. Closest websafe color is: #99ff66.

Shades and Tints of #86ef5d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#061102 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#86ef5d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a4aba1 is the less saturated color, while #80fd4f is the most saturated one.
